  1. What is Yarn Manufacturing Process?

  2. Cotton yarn is one of the most popular types of yarn used for a variety of textiles, including bed linen, bath textiles, clothing, and home décor. When you choose cotton, you can always get comfort and style with affordable durability. It is always one of the top-tier textiles used for a variety of applications. If you are in love with cotton fabric, you must know the manufacturing process. The manufacturing process of cotton involves weaving as well as spinning, which is lengthy and helps in getting quality cotton fabric for producing finished goods and products. 

  3. Let Us Quickly Take A Look At The Cotton Yarn Manufacturing Process. 1- The spinning of cotton yarn is the initial stage of textile product processing. The process of producing yarns from the extracted fibers is called spinning. 2- The strands of cotton fibers are twisted together to form yarn. 3- The yarn is placed on the rings of the spinning frame and is allowed to pass through several sets of rollers, which are rotating at a successively higher speed. 4-The yarn is rolled by the rollers and wound up on the desired bobbins.  5-This is the final stage of spinning the cotton yarn, in which drafting, twisting, and winding of the yarn are all completed in one operation. 6-The bobbins filled with yarn are then removed from the ring frames and used for processing for bleaching and the weaving process. 

  4. Cotton Finishing The woven cloth is converted into useful material; this is known as finishing. The textile material is treated with bleach and dyes to enhance its quality.
